-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: > I have KDE 3.5.3 installed. In Konqueror I would like to be able to > access smb network shares, but when I type in "smb://domain/sharename" I > get a message saying "protocol not supported". I have the > "kdebase3-ssl" and the "kdenetwork3-base" packages installed (and all > the other required packages too). > > Will I need to install the samba package via fink, or is there a way to > make KDE/Konqueror look for Apple's samba package?
samba3 (which is required for kde's SMB support) is not ported in Fink, so there is no SMB support in KDE. :( I haven't really had a chance to look into porting it, I've got too much on my plate as it is, but if someone's interested in packagaging it, I'd be happy to help out. :) - -- Benjamin Reed a.k.a.
